Research in Chemistry (MSc)
Programme structure
The research specialisation offers you the opportunity to spend two full years on training in a research area to become an independent and creative scientist.
Programme outline
The research specialisation comprises research training projects to a total of at least 60 EC, including a presentation for the research group and a written report, the master's thesis. You follow four core courses (24 EC) from one of the two research areas Chemical Biology or Energy & Sustainability. Students in the research specialisation train their communication skills via the essay and colloquium (6 EC).

The Research in Chemistry master offers you many opportunities to create your own programme. You will have the possibility to carry out a research training project abroad at another university or company or follow courses abroad.
